To find the two possible answers to 35x^2 + 33x - 90 = 0, we will start by rewriting the equation in factored form. Then, we will create two separate equations that we can use to solve 35x² + 33x - 90 = 0.

Below is 35x squared plus 33x minus 90 in factored form. As you can see, 35x² + 33x - 90 has been grouped into two sets of parentheses.

(5x - 6)(7x + 15)

Next, we set each set of parentheses equal to 0 and solve for x to get the two answers to 35x^2 + 33x - 90 = 0.

(5x - 6) = 0
x1 = 1 1/5

(7x + 15) = 0
x2 = -2 1/7
